  • Prophecy against Mount Seir

    And the word of Jehovah came unto me, saying,
  • A Message for Edom

    Again a message came to me from the LORD:
  • Son of man, set thy face against mount Seir, and prophesy against it,
  • “Son of man, turn and face Mount Seir, and prophesy against its people.
  • and say unto it, Thus saith the Lord Jehovah: Behold, I am against thee, mount Seir, and I will stretch out my hand upon thee, and I will make thee a desolation and an astonishment.
  • Give them this message from the Sovereign LORD:
    “I am your enemy, O Mount Seir,
    and I will raise my fist against you
    to destroy you completely.
  • I will lay thy cities waste, and thou shalt be a desolation: and thou shalt know that I [am] Jehovah.
  • I will demolish your cities
    and make you desolate.
    Then you will know that I am the LORD.
  • Because thou hast had a perpetual hatred, and hast given over the children of Israel to the power of the sword, in the time of their calamity, in the time of the iniquity of the end;
  • “Your eternal hatred for the people of Israel led you to butcher them when they were helpless, when I had already punished them for all their sins.
  • therefore, [as] I live, saith the Lord Jehovah, I will certainly appoint thee unto blood, and blood shall pursue thee; since thou hast not hated blood, blood shall pursue thee.
  • As surely as I live, says the Sovereign LORD, since you show no distaste for blood, I will give you a bloodbath of your own. Your turn has come!
  • And I will make mount Seir a desolation and an astonishment, and cut off from it him that passeth out and him that returneth;
  • I will make Mount Seir utterly desolate, killing off all who try to escape and any who return.
  • and I will fill his mountains with his slain. In thy hills, and in thy valleys, and in all thy water-courses shall they fall that are slain with the sword.
  • I will fill your mountains with the dead. Your hills, your valleys, and your ravines will be filled with people slaughtered by the sword.
  • I will make thee perpetual desolations, and thy cities shall not be inhabited: and ye shall know that I [am] Jehovah.
  • I will make you desolate forever. Your cities will never be rebuilt. Then you will know that I am the LORD.
  • Because thou hast said, These two nations and these two countries shall be mine, and we will possess it, whereas Jehovah was there:
  • “For you said, ‘The lands of Israel and Judah will be ours. We will take possession of them. What do we care that the LORD is there!’
  • therefore, [as] I live, saith the Lord Jehovah, I will even do according to thine anger and according to thine envy, as thou hast done out of thy hatred against them; and I will make myself known among them, when I shall judge thee.
  • Therefore, as surely as I live, says the Sovereign LORD, I will pay back your angry deeds with my own. I will punish you for all your acts of anger, envy, and hatred. And I will make myself known to Israela by what I do to you.
  • And thou shalt know that I Jehovah have heard all thy reproaches, which thou hast uttered against the mountains of Israel, saying, They are laid desolate, they are given us to devour.
  • Then you will know that I, the LORD, have heard every contemptuous word you spoke against the mountains of Israel. For you said, ‘They are desolate; they have been given to us as food to eat!’
  • And ye have magnified yourselves against me with your mouth, and have multiplied your words against me: I have heard [them].
  • In saying that, you boasted proudly against me, and I have heard it all!
  • Thus saith the Lord Jehovah: When the whole earth rejoiceth, I will make thee a desolation.
  • “This is what the Sovereign LORD says: The whole world will rejoice when I make you desolate.
  • As thou didst rejoice at the inheritance of the house of Israel, because it was desolated, so will I do unto thee: thou shalt be a desolation, O mount Seir, and all Edom, the whole of it: and they shall know that I [am] Jehovah.
  • You rejoiced at the desolation of Israel’s territory. Now I will rejoice at yours! You will be wiped out, you people of Mount Seir and all who live in Edom! Then you will know that I am the LORD.
